Was injured a couple times as well I thought it was a huge mistake to let Hayward go. We didn't have any proven talent at the CB position with the exception of Shields and we saw what the result was last year. Ted Thompson's philosophy of always going with the younger guy is killing this team as our window is closing. Its sickening. I'm tired of seeing other teams making deals while TT sits around and does nothing. Look at what the Broncos did to build a great defense. They had a lousy defense in 2013 and got throttled in the Super Bowl. They then go out and rehaul their defensive scheme and they picked up some key guys like Aqib Talib, Demarcus Ware, and TJ Ward and some stopgap guys on DL. Talib was the Broncos version of our Woodson acquisition. They turned a lousy defense into a downright frightening defense in a couple years. We've got 4-5 years of Aaron Rodgers in his prime left. We are running out of time to be relying on young draft picks to develop on the defensive side of the ball.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
